New method of level of service estimation for two-lane rural roads in Poland
Research on a new method for level of service estimation and assessment on long sections of two-lane two-directional rural roads in Poland is reported in the paper. Mean speed, its standard deviation, and 95th percentile of passenger car speed distribution have been chosen as level of service measures. Mathematical models to estimate their values were developed by means of factor analysis and multiple regression application. The models are expected to be useful for road planning and designing.
